Leveraging Big Data and Machine Learning for Risk Prediction
Apply machine learning models to historical security data to predict emerging vulnerabilities, anomalies, and breach patterns.
Machine learning models trained on years of security logs can detect subtle patterns humans miss. They identify anomalous user behavior (login from unusual location, unusual data access), predict which systems are likely to be compromised next based on similar historical incidents, and forecast vulnerability emergence in specific software versions. Big data platforms like Spark enable processing of terabytes of logs in near-real time. Models improve continuously as new data arrives. Unlike rules-based systems that require explicit programming of every threat signature, ML adapts to novel attacks. Challenges include data quality, false-positive tuning, and the need for labeled training data.
